BREAKING CHANGE: - Injector was renamed into `ReflectiveInjector`, as `Injector` is only an abstract class with one method on it - `Injector.getOptional()` was changed into `Injector.get(token, notFoundValue)` to make implementing injectors simpler - `ViewContainerRef.createComponent` now takes an `Injector` instead of `ResolvedProviders`. If a reflective injector should be used, create one before calling this method. (e.g. via `ReflectiveInjector.resolveAndCreate(…)`.
